Best Affordable Skincare for Sensitive Skin: Drugstore Finds

Finding affordable skincare for sensitive skin can be a bit of a challenge, but it's definitely possible! Here are some great places to look:

Drugstores:

* CeraVe: Known for its gentle, fragrance-free formulas, CeraVe offers a wide range of products specifically designed for sensitive skin. They're a great budget-friendly option.

* La Roche-Posay: Another reliable brand for sensitive skin, La Roche-Posay's products are formulated with minimal ingredients and are often hypoallergenic.

* Vanicream: This brand focuses on creating products specifically for sensitive and eczema-prone skin. They offer cleansers, moisturizers, and even sunscreens that are free of common irritants.

* Aveeno: Aveeno's products often contain soothing ingredients like colloidal oatmeal, making them well-suited for sensitive skin.

* Cetaphil: Cetaphil is known for its gentle cleansers and moisturizers that are suitable for even the most sensitive skin.

Tips for finding affordable sensitive skin products:

* Look for products with minimal ingredients: The fewer ingredients, the less likely it is to irritate your skin.

* Choose fragrance-free products: Fragrances are a common irritant for sensitive skin.

* Avoid products with harsh chemicals: Parabens, sulfates, and alcohol can be irritating to sensitive skin.

* Read reviews: Check out what other people with sensitive skin have to say about the products you're considering.

Remember: Always patch test any new product on a small area of your skin before applying it to your entire face. If you experience any irritation, discontinue use and consult a dermatologist.

It's also important to be mindful of your skincare routine as a whole. Don't over-exfoliate, use lukewarm water instead of hot water, and always moisturize after cleansing.
